#d55949 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d55949 is composed of 83.5% red, 34.9% green and 28.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 58.2% magenta, 65.7%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 6.9 degrees, a saturation of 62.5% and a lightness of 56.1%. #d55949 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b292 with #ab0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

Shades and Tints of #d55949

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090302 is the darkest color, while #fdf9f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d55949

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#908e8e is the less saturated color, while #f73e27 is the most saturated one.
